on Dec 1, 2012
Ben Englert
Hello, I'm Ben.
I love creating great software, traveling to new and familiar places, making and listening to music, and talking to interesting people.
If you think I can help you by doing any (or preferably all) of those, please get in touch!
As far as work environments, I'm a huge fan of "work where you want, when you want". I like to spend some time at the office to stay in sync with the team, but am also very productive as a remote worker so I appreciate flexibility a great deal.
Lots of references available on request.
Technologies
Experience (7) show all
Independent Consultant
2010 - Current
Some projects I have done as a (mostly) one-man show:
Suggested, refined, and implemented core UX in mobile apps.
Puppetized a complex infrastructure for a seamless transition from Rackspace to EC2.
Designed a process for automatically generating cross-platform native apps, then migrated it from homebrew tools to the Trigger.io standalone build API.
Taken a number of iOS app ideas from a few sketches to a fully functioning, submitted-to-the-App-Store app.
Taken over an iOS codebase abandoned by a team of shady contractors, cleaned up the codebase significantly, updated it to use new APIs and added features.
Co-ordinated the efforts of designers and other content creators (photographers etc), some of whom came from a web background and were unfamiliar with the territory (iOS), to efficiently deliver a content-rich app.
iPod Accessory Protocol Verification Co-Op, Apple Inc.
January 2012 - July 2012
Built and enhanced tools and technologies to enable verification of the iPod Accessory Protocol implementation in new releases of iOS (iPhone/iPod touch/iPad) and RTXC (iPod nano/iPod classic)
Global Strategic Technology Co-op, Steinway & Sons
January 2011 - August 2011
Founding member of a new music technology team at Steinway
Designed and implemented distributed music conversion pipeline on EC2
Contributed to the architecture of a scalable backend that securely accepts payments & delivers music files
Technical liaison to vendors and partners for an audio hardware prototyping project
Firmware Engineer Intern, SandForce
May 2010 - August 2010
Firmware development for SandForce's SF-1200 and SF-1500 SSD storage controller.
Development of tools for SSD testing, manufacturing, and customer enablement.
Managed open source code contributions.
Software Engineer, Kalexo
May 2008 - April 2010
Maintained and added features to desktop and server software built on a wide variety of tools.
Built and maintained iPhone version of Kalexo’s Teamwork software.
Ported Teamwork to Mac OS X.
Distributed system design in Java on Linux and Amazon EC2
Software Intern, Ubicom
June 2008 - August 2008
Embedded C programming for Ubicom’s IP5000 CPU and ipOS real-time operating system for home networking & media product.
Developed a sample project for Ubicom SDK.
Developed a user-mode device driver for Windows Vista
Software Intern, Neetek Systems Integration, Inc
June 2006 - August 2006
Contract-based enterprise web application development
Customization of popular open source packages such as XOOPS and eGroupWare for use in enterprise websites and intranets
Communication with customers through formal documentation
Education
Computer Science & Music Technology, Northeastern University
2008 - 2012
Built the fastest raytracer (by an order of magnitude) in my Computer Graphics class - 512x512 scene rendered in 12 seconds where next fastest solution took over 1 minute on the same hardware.
Composed a real-time piece of music in Clojure and Max MSP whose content and structure was driven by the content of text messages received from the audience during the performance.
Stack Exchange show all Last seen today
Accounts
Open Source show all
clocaltunnel
GitHub, Oct 2012 - Mar 2013
A Localtunnel client written in C, designed for embeddability.
Apps & Software show all
Etude is the ultimate app for learning how to play music on the piano.
Made significant contributions to the UI & e-commerce logic code on the client side, as well as enhancements to the music conversion and delivery pipeline
SandForce, Inc., is transforming data storage by pioneering the use of commodity flash memory in enterprise and client computing applications with its innovative SSD (Solid State…
Wrote a Linux driver in C and client code + GUI in Python to allow the SF-1200 to be brought up in a manufacturing context over SAS and PCI busses, enabling its use in products based around those technologies.
Record audio directly to CD. Quickly create audio CDs using your Mac’s internal mic, built-in audio input, or an external audio interface.
I built this application for my own use and then released it on the Mac App Store.
Tools
Power Macintosh 7100/66
TextMate
